🏘️ Little Washington Public Housing Community (600 Whitfield Drive)

This long‑standing public housing development at 600 Whitfield Drive serves as the anchor of the Little Washington neighborhood, offering affordable family accommodations and a dedicated community center that fosters neighborhood cohesion.

🌳 Henry C. Mitchell Park

A small open‑space park of about one acre nestled along Whitfield Drive adjacent to the railway; though no longer equipped with amenities, it remains a green breathing space within Little Washington’s residential fabric.

🏫 Historic Dillard School area along South Georgia Avenue & West Chestnut Street

This area, part of early‑20th‑century development, includes the historic Dillard School and surrounding neighborhood where many African‑American railroad workers and their families lived, reflecting the rich heritage of Little Washington.
